SETIA ERAT

Oil service / PSV, IMO 9543225

SETIA ERAT is currently in the Malaysian Exclusive Economic Zone, last seen less than 1h ago

The vessel was built in 2010, and is sailing under the flag of Malaysia. Her length overall (LOA) is 59 meters, and her width (beam) is 15 meters. Her summer deadweight capacity is 1,475 tonnes.
